Halo fans likely have another reason to keep an eye on the calendar. A fresh leak from the trusted data miner grunt.api—the same one whose Halo universe leaks rarely turn out to be empty—has revealed the expected release dates for Halo: Campaign Evolved. Moreover, the information is presented in a spirit of riddles, codes, and mathematics.

This week has already been a busy one: insiders previously reported that the project is “being completed from start to finish” and will feature a customizable skin system. Now the key question is: when? Two equations – two keys

In a tweet on X (formerly Twitter), grunt.api published two expressions:

  • EA: (18 × 7 × (MMXX + VI) mod 31) + 1
  • OR: (8 × 7 × (MMXX + VI) mod 31) + 1

The community quickly put together the equation: EA – Early Access, OR – Official Release. MMXX + VI = 2026 (in Roman numerals). They solved it – and got:

  • Early Access – Thursday, July 23rd
  • Official release – Tuesday, July 28th

Coincidence? Hard to believe. Both days are workdays, and the gap between EA and the release is only five days. For a AAA project with digital distribution, this scenario is more than realistic.

Skepticism is a must, but grunt.api is no newbie

Yes, the source is unofficial. Yes, the equations are beautiful, but mysterious. However, grunt.api has more than one accurate Halo leak under its belt. If the information is accurate, the official announcement and pre-orders should be expected at the Xbox Game Showcase on June 7th. It makes sense: Microsoft’s summer show, followed by a July release. Halo: Campaign Evolved—what is it and how does it work?

Essentially, this is a full-fledged remake of the campaign from the original Halo: Combat Evolved, which was released… scary to say… in 2001. Halo Studios didn’t repaint the old game; they rebuilt the levels from scratch in Unreal Engine 5. An important detail: there will be no multiplayer. At all. Only a single-player campaign.

Halo Campaign Evolved gameplay

There’s a ton of content: over ten missions with a completely redesigned design, plus new prequel levels. They’ve added sprinting (finally), and the familiar arsenal from Halo Infinite—so old fans won’t get lost. The cinematics have been re-animated in 4K, and the soundtrack has been remastered. The original voices: Steve Downes and Jen Taylor are back at the mic. Chief and Cortana are back in action.

PS5, co-op, and a historic step

The biggest moment is the PS5 launch. Yes, Master Chief is coming to Sony’s console. Expanding the audience beyond the Xbox ecosystem is an unprecedented step for the franchise. It’s timed to coincide with the series’ 25th anniversary. Four-player online co-op, split-screen multiplayer on consoles, and cross-progression are all here.

The remake lays the foundation for future installments: newcomers will have an easier time getting into the Covenant and Spartan lore. The graphics lack the visual flair of Anniversary 2011, but with UE5 mechanics: navigation, combat pacing—everything has become faster and more intuitive.
